97d16a800f4ca52571b6874703e93471ef66eaab4a8ca2503ac813d867f5d21d

1601563 (202845 blocks ago)

⏴ Block 1601562 (d7a93e04...fe6) | Block 1601564 ⏵ | Latest block ⏭

Metadata

6/7/24, 1:28 AM UTC (281d 17:30:32 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details